Andrews:
Floride Josey Reynolds, 93, widow of Julian A. "Bud" Reynolds, died Friday, October 13, 2006 at home.
Mrs. Reynolds was born in Lee County on August 19, 1913. She was a daughter of the late Luther Fleming Josey and Edith Scarborough Josey.
Mrs. Reynolds was a graduate of Coker College in Hartsville and taught school in Lee County until she married. She was a homemaker and "managed" Reynolds Drug Store until her retirement. Mrs. Reynolds was a member of the Andrews Presbyterian Church, where she taught Sunday School for many years, and an active member of the Women of the Church.
